Property tax in Mant

32.13%

municipal rate on buildings, set in 2025 · unchanged since 2023

Median for towns of its size band: 34.53%.

In 2024, Mant collected 92 k€ in property and residence taxes, or 21% of its revenue.

Debt

1,756

per inhabitant at end of 2024 · 485 k€ in total

Towns of its size: €371 per inhabitant · +44.0 % per inhabitant since 2018

Outstanding debt and gross savings: OFGL, main budget. The number of years is the debt-repayment capacity, debt divided by gross savings.
